epäjärjestelmä
Epäjärjestelmä refers to a concept in Finnish language and culture that describes a state of disorder or lack of systematic organization. The term is often used in discussions about societal structures, bureaucracy, and everyday life, highlighting situations where rules, processes, or expectations are inconsistent, unclear, or poorly enforced.
